Paprika Oil & Preserved Lemon BBQ Prawns
24 large raw king prawns, peeled and deveined (leave tails on)
8 skewers (metal or wooden)
2-3 Tbsp Zee’s paprika oil
1 heap Tbsp diced Zee’s preserved lemon
Pinch sea salt
To serve: handful fresh coriander, fresh lemon wedges
Serves: 4
If you are using wooden skewers soak them in water first for 30 minutes to prevent burning.
Place peeled prawns in a large bowl. Drizzle in paprika oil and top with preserved lemon and sea salt. Toss so prawns are well coated.
Cover bowl and put the prawns in the fridge to marinate for at least 30 minutes.
Thread 3 prawns per skewer.
Preheat your BBQ to medium-high heat then BBQ the skewers on both sides for 2-3 minutes per side, until prawns are cooked through.
Place prawns on a serving plate and top with roughly chopped coriander and lemon wedges.
